Written by members of the Hughston Society, this text focuses on the concerns involved in treating the injured athlete. Practical guidelines are included to aid complete rehabilitation and a return to action for patients. The scope of the book is useful for all team physicians whether they are working with scholastic athletes or professionals. There is information on all aspects of being a well-prepared team physician, including essential material on establishing a sports medicine program, injury epidemiology, preparticipation physical, and the legal aspects of being a team physician. Nearly 100 chapters cover a range of sports-related injuries logically arranged by section of the body. Each chapter discusses the mechanisms of injury, diagnosing injury, and conservative and surgical options. The coverage details medical conditions encountered by athletes of all ages.
